    And now to the nitty gritty
    I enjoy my Subaru but as of late my LGT decided to take a major break on me based on my lack of knowledge and maintenance of the Legacy's oil line. And because of that my LGT's turbo blew and out of commission. The turbo on my LGT is a VF40. Yes, it was my fault for not checking that. I had no idea.

    I've done some extensive research about the problem and even took out the turbo to take a look at it. Sure enough the turbine shaft is broken and will be needing a new turbo soon. (like right now)

    I've decided that instead of going for a used turbo, I'll be getting a brand new turbo from BNR EVO 16G compressor wheel/TD05H turbine wheel (max-rated at 300 WHP). Pretty much this will be a upgraded stock turbo from BNR

    First, welcome to the forum! You may want to create a thread in the modifications/maintenance section.

    As far as your turbo install - there are many people here who have experience (some better than others) and may be willing to help. Otherwise, you may want to contact NF, as they specialize in Subarus and are very reasonable. There are several other good local aftermarket shops as well.

    With the new turbo, you will need a new tune as well - which Nuke from NF does awesome tuning work! You may also want to research supporting mods - for example: upgraded fuel pump, injectors, down pipe, etc.

    STOP!!! If the turbo went from lack of oil, you had better drop the oil pan and check for metal shavings in there. You may have bigger problems. The small metal particles will get everywhere else in the engine and cause MAJOR damage. When it comes to a tune NF is your shop.
